I picked up an 07 G Sedan with about 25k miles, and the previous owner apparently did a bit of highway driving. ALthough the front bumper isnt in horrible shape, i would prefer it to be near flawless. How much should i expect to pay to have the front bumper resprayed? I'll probably end up adding a clear-bra after it's painted if i go that route as well..

It depends where you're having it done (i.e. where you're located). Around here (TX) the bumper will cost around $300-500 to spray. If blending is done with the fenders, in the $1k range.

I would be more concerned with the paint matching or the plastic prepped and painted properly with flex agent so it doesn't flake off after a few years. I've had that problem twice by two different shops!
